But here's what separates effective gratitude practice from performative positivity: specificity. Generic gratitude ("I'm grateful for my family") doesn't trigger the same neurochemical cascade as detailed, sensory-rich gratitude ("I'm grateful for the way my daughter laughed at breakfast this morning—that genuine, unguarded laugh that came from her belly"). The more specific and emotionally authentic your gratitude, the more your brain registers it as real and relevant.

In 2026, the most effective gratitude practice isn't the generic "list three things" approach. Instead, try the sensory-anchored method: choose one experience from your day and write down exactly what you perceived through each sense. What did you see? Hear? Feel texturally? Taste? Smell? This engages more of your brain and creates stronger neural pathways associated with appreciation.

What makes this different from toxic positivity is that authentic gratitude acknowledges difficulty. You can be grateful for lessons learned during hardship. You can appreciate the strength you discovered while struggling. This nuance prevents gratitude from becoming spiritual bypassing—using positive thinking to avoid genuine emotional processing.
The research is compelling: people who maintain consistent gratitude practices show measurable decreases in cortisol levels, improved immune function, better sleep architecture, and reduced symptoms of depression and anxiety. But the effect isn't instant. Neuroplasticity requires repetition. Most studies show meaningful shifts appear around week three to four of daily practice, with compounding benefits over months.
